diesel has much more torque on low revs = difficult to drive out of corners (and lower top speed)
ulead fuel cars has more torque on higher revs = easier to drive but much more fuel consumption (and higher top speed)
the diesel has the advantage that is has a better powerfactor.... but see what audi had to do before launch the R10... gearbox of R8 (tested... 100km and gearbox broken...)
tyres were too small and too weak so they had spinning wheels all the time... just made a low sense gaspedal and special tyres by michelin...
these were just a few piont for diesel and unleaded fuel cars comparisation ^^
